Walter Anderson

    Walter Inglis Anderson si immerse profondamente nei regni della natura e dell'arte per scoprire verità universali. I suoi ampi interessi spaziavano dalla poesia, alla storia, alle scienze naturali e alla storia dell'arte, permettendogli di integrare diverse tradizioni nel suo lavoro. Anderson era spinto dal desiderio di connettersi con il mondo naturale, sforzandosi non solo di documentare il suo ambiente, ma di diventarne parte integrante. Il suo approccio artistico, caratterizzato da opere intense ed evocative, riflette la sua incessante ricerca di significato e connessione. Scoperto per caso, il lascito artistico di Anderson offre agli spettatori uno sguardo affascinante sulla sua visione unica.

    • The Confidence Course

      Seven Steps to Self-Fulfillment

      • 237pagine
      • 9 ore di lettura

      This book offers practical, insightful advice grounded in real-life experience, moving beyond typical feel-good counseling. It serves as a powerful guide for those struggling with self-doubt, helping readers transform anxiety into an ally. Through 20 interactive lessons filled with exercises and real-life examples, the author combines storytelling with Marine Corps training to teach essential life skills. Topics include overcoming shyness, handling mistakes and criticism, understanding anger, and making meaningful life choices. The author is praised as a modern-day Dale Carnegie, providing memorable principles and rules for living. Readers will find inspiration in the clear, concise writing, with valuable insights on giving and receiving criticism. This book is particularly beneficial for young people seeking guidance and confidence. It emphasizes the importance of values and ethics, aiming to build a stronger, more confident generation. The author’s journey from self-doubt to confidence serves as a testament to the transformative power of the lessons within. Overall, this book is a compelling resource for anyone looking to embrace their fears and pursue a fulfilling life, offering keys to creative choice and human values for dynamic living.
